The Cable's Role in the Spring-to-Door Load Path in Lindon

The torsion spring stores energy as rotational tension in the spring coil in Lindon, UT. When the door opens, the spring releases that rotational energy through the torsion shaft to the cable drums on each end of the shaft in Lindon. As the drums rotate, they wind the cables up from the drum groove, pulling the cables upward in Lindon, UT. The cables attach at their lower ends to the bottom brackets at the lower corners of the door in Lindon. As the cables are pulled upward by the rotating drums, they transmit the spring's stored energy as a lifting force at the bottom corners of the door in Lindon, UT. The cable converts the spring's rotational energy into the linear upward force that lifts the door in Lindon.

Where Cables Attach and Why Those Points Fail Most Often in Lindon, UT

The cable attaches to the drum at the upper end and to the bottom bracket fitting at the lower end in Lindon. Both attachment points are where the cable changes direction, from linear tension to wrapping around the drum at the top, and from linear tension to a fixed point at the bottom fitting in Lindon, UT. Direction changes in a loaded cable create stress concentrations at the bending point in Lindon. This is why most cable failures occur at or near one of the two attachment points rather than in the middle of the cable run in Lindon, UT.

How Drum Winding Affects Cable Wear in Lindon

The cable drum has a helical groove that guides the cable into a specific winding path as the drum rotates in Lindon, UT. When the cable winds correctly in the groove, the cable to drum contact is distributed across the full cable diameter against the smooth groove surface in Lindon. When the cable miswinds, jumping out of the groove or stacking on top of a previous wrap, the cable contacts the sharp edge of the adjacent groove or wrap in Lindon, UT. This edge contact acts as a cutting mechanism that progressively cuts through the cable strands with each winding cycle in Lindon.

The Five Most Common Causes of Cable Failure in Lindon, UT

Spring failure shock load, the cable snaps from the sudden tension surge when a spring breaks during door operation in Lindon. Drum groove wear, the groove wears to a sharp edge that cuts through cable strands in Lindon, UT. Incorrect drum winding, cable contacts the drum flange or crosses over previous wraps from a previous repair error in Lindon. Corrosion, moisture penetrates between wire strands and weakens the individual wires progressively in Lindon, UT. Physical damage, external contact bends or kinks the cable at a specific point in Lindon.

Why the Cause Determines the Associated Repair in Lindon, UT

A cable that failed from a spring failure shock load requires spring replacement alongside cable replacement in Lindon. Without the spring replacement, the new cable is immediately exposed to the same shock load risk from the same broken spring in Lindon, UT. A cable that failed from drum groove wear requires drum assessment and potentially drum replacement in Lindon. A cable that failed from incorrect winding requires correct winding procedure on the replacement in Lindon, UT. Each cause has a specific associated repair in Lindon.

The Full Door Weight Shifts to One Cable in Lindon

A correctly functioning two-cable system distributes the door weight evenly between both cables, both drums, and both bottom brackets in Lindon, UT. Each side carries approximately half the door weight in Lindon. When one cable fails, the remaining cable is carrying the full door weight in Lindon, UT. For a 200-pound door, the intact cable has gone from carrying 100 pounds to 200 pounds in Lindon. The cable, drum, and bracket on the intact side are all operating at twice their designed load in Lindon, UT.

Why the Hardware on the Intact Side Is at Risk in Lindon, UT

The intact cable carrying double its designed load is operating at a significantly higher fraction of its rated breaking strength in Lindon. The drum on the intact side has the full cable tension rather than half in Lindon, UT. The bottom bracket on the intact side is bearing the full door weight at its attachment points in Lindon. All three components are more likely to fail under the doubled load in Lindon, UT. A second failure in any of these components drops the door completely in Lindon.

Correct Cable Specification — Diameter, Length, Construction in Lindon

Garage door cables are specified by wire diameter, overall length, and construction type in Lindon, UT. The correct wire diameter is determined by the door's weight and the cable's required working load limit in Lindon. A cable undersized for the door weight operates at a higher fraction of its rated breaking strength on every cycle, accelerating fatigue and reducing service life in Lindon, UT. The correct length is determined by the door height and the drum configuration in Lindon. EZ Open selects replacement cables with the correct specification for the specific door's weight and configuration in Lindon, UT.

Correct Drum Winding — The Step Most Often Skipped in Lindon

The cable drum has a helical groove machined into its surface that guides the cable into the correct winding path in Lindon, UT. The cable must be started in the correct position on the drum and wound in the correct direction for the specific side of the door being repaired in Lindon. A cable started in the wrong position miswinds from the first cycle and immediately begins accumulating the cutting wear that produced the original failure in Lindon, UT. EZ Open confirms correct winding visually before the cable is loaded on every cable replacement in Lindon.

Tension Equalization Between Both Cables in Lindon, UT

After both cables are installed and wound, EZ Open checks the door height across its full width by measuring from the floor to the bottom of the door at both ends in Lindon. Any height difference indicates unequal cable tension in Lindon, UT. The adjustment is made to match the height across the full door width in Lindon. Equal cable tension produces correct door height and correct load distribution between both sides in Lindon, UT.

A cable that's come off the drum without snapping has typically jumped out of the helical groove during operation in Lindon. This can happen from a sudden release of tension, physical disturbance, or a drum groove that's worn enough to no longer reliably retain the cable in Lindon, UT. If the drum groove itself is undamaged, the cable can often be correctly reseated and rewound in Lindon. If the drum groove shows wear or damage, drum replacement may be needed alongside the cable correction in Lindon, UT.

No, it's a different component in Lindon. Extension spring systems use a separate safety cable that runs through the center of each extension spring, anchored at both ends in Lindon, UT. Its purpose is to contain the spring if it breaks, preventing it from becoming a projectile in Lindon. This is different from the lift cable that connects the spring system to the bottom corner of the door in Lindon, UT.
